Best Buy

In 1966, Best Buy was founded as Sound of Music, Best Buy is now an American multinational consumer electronics retailer. The company sells a range of items, including TVs, home theatre systems, computers, smartphones, laptops, cameras video games, and wearable tech. The company also offers a variety of services, including in-store pickup and delivery and the policy of free returns. Best Buy is known for its seasonal sales, such as Black Friday and Back to School. Discounts of up to 60% are offered.

The online store of the company offers an extensive selection of products and a user-friendly shopping experience. Its top deals section includes offerings like AirPods, MacBooks and gaming consoles and accessories. The refurbished items and open-box items are also available at reduced prices. The site of the company also has an online tool to help shoppers find the lowest price, and a guarantee on identical in-stock items.

If you're who want to save even more For those looking to save more, the Best Buy app offers special sales and alerts which aren't usually advertised in stores. The app's features include deals of the day and a Best Buy Outlet section that offers clearance lines as well as refurbished and open-box items, and pre-owned products. Customers can also monitor their order status on the app and contact customer service.

Best Buy offers a trade-in program in-store. The company accepts all types of devices from cameras to laptops and video games. They also pay in cash or in store credit, which is an advantage for those who want to use the device for an upgrade. Other retailers across the country, like GameStop and Verizon Wireless, will also accept older devices in exchange for credit. If you're not looking to get store credit, or don't have time to sell your device, you might consider using a trade-in website like Swappa.
